Item No. A12.35373.  Southside Life-Saving Station headquarters building at Ocean Beach, west of Lake Merced, San Francisco, California, circa 1930-1940

Creator/Collector: Christensen, Carl M. (Carl Mobius)
Extent: 1 photograph.
Physical Description: 1 black-and-white silver-gelatin photographic print, 8 x 10 in., pl (8 x 10 in.)

Scope and Content Note

This image appears in an article by Ralph Shanks, Jr., titled "The United States Life-Saving Service in California: Conclusion" which was published in the Summer 1980 issue of the National Maritime Museum's "Sea Letter," no. 31, page 2.
